Product details
Overview
The MAX4618CEE+T from Analog Devices is a high-speed, low-voltage CMOS dual 4-channel analog multiplexer operating from a single +2V to +5.5V supply. It features rail-to-rail signal handling, 15ns turn-on time, 10ns turn-off time, and guaranteed 10Ω max on-resistance at +5V - enabling precise signal routing in battery-powered audio/video systems and low-voltage data-acquisition front-ends.
For engineers reviewing the MAX4618CEE+T datasheet, MAX4618CEE+T pinout, MAX4618CEE+T application, or MAX4618CEE+T equivalent, this device is selected for designs requiring fast, low-leakage, TTL/CMOS-compatible switching with minimal channel-to-channel crosstalk (-96dB) and high off-isolation (-93dB) in space-constrained TSSOP-16 layouts.
Technical Context
The MAX4618CEE+T integrates two independent 4-channel analog multiplexers sharing common address (A, B) and enable inputs. Each multiplexer routes one of four analog inputs (X0–X3 or Y0–Y3) to its respective output (X or Y) under digital control, with break-before-make switching and guaranteed monotonic on-resistance across temperature.
Its BiCMOS process delivers low charge injection (3pC), low on-resistance match (≤1Ω at +5V), and stable performance over ±2.5V to ±5.5V analog signal ranges. Input logic thresholds scale with VCC (2.4V min at +5V; 2.0V min at +3V), ensuring compatibility across mixed-supply systems without level shifters.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Supply Voltage | +2V to +5.5V single supply - supports direct integration into 3.3V and 5V systems without regulators. |
| On-Resistance (max) | 10Ω at +5V - ensures minimal signal attenuation and gain error in precision sensor or audio paths. |
| tON/tOFF | 15ns / 10ns - enables high-speed multiplexing in sampling systems up to ~30MHz effective rate. |
| Off-Leakage Current | 1nA at +25°C - preserves accuracy in high-impedance measurement nodes (e.g., pH sensors, photodiode amps). |
| Crosstalk / Off-Isolation | -96dB / -93dB at 100kHz - prevents interference between active and inactive channels in multi-signal routing. |
| Logic Compatibility | TTL/CMOS thresholds (0.8V–2.4V at +5V) - interfaces directly with microcontrollers and FPGAs without glue logic. |
| Package | 16-pin TSSOP (EE) - 5mm × 4.4mm footprint suitable for compact portable and industrial PCBs. |

FAQ
What is the maximum analog signal voltage range supported by the MAX4618CEE+T?
The MAX4618CEE+T supports rail-to-rail analog signals from 0V to VCC. When operated at +5V supply, the analog input/output range is 0V to +5V; at +3.3V supply, it is 0V to +3.3V. Exceeding VCC or going below GND risks forward-biasing internal ESD diodes, so signals must remain within these bounds for reliable operation. The MAX4618CEE+T does not support dual-supply or negative-voltage operation.
Does the MAX4618CEE+T require external pull-up or pull-down resistors on its address or enable pins?
No, the MAX4618CEE+T does not require external pull-up or pull-down resistors on A, B, or ENABLE pins. Its digital inputs have guaranteed TTL/CMOS-compatible thresholds (0.8V low, 2.4V high at +5V) and draw less than 1µA input current. However, ENABLE should be actively driven - tying it permanently low enables both multiplexers, while driving it high disables all channels. Floating ENABLE is not recommended due to potential noise-induced switching.
Can the MAX4618CEE+T be used in bidirectional signal paths?
Yes, the MAX4618CEE+T supports fully bidirectional analog signal flow. Its CMOS switch architecture makes input and output pins functionally identical - X0–X3 and Y0–Y3 can serve as either sources or sinks, and X/Y outputs can accept signals from external sources. This enables flexible use in analog crosspoint matrices, feedback path switching, and I/O multiplexing without directional constraints. The MAX4618CEE+T datasheet explicitly confirms interchangeability of all analog terminals.
